The Senior Producer leads cross-functional teams in the planning, execution, and delivery of complex game development and engineering projects. This role is responsible for driving the full production lifecycle — from concept to launch — ensuring milestones, deliverables, and technical dependencies are met on schedule and within scope. Operating as both a strategic partner and executional leader, the Senior Producer aligns creative vision with technical implementation, balancing priorities across design, engineering, and QA teams. The role requires exceptional communication, organization, and leadership skills to foster collaboration, manage risks, and maintain development velocity in a fast-paced, iterative environment.
